RED RIVER, a co. in the NE part of Texas,
bordering on Red river. Soil, especially in
the northern and middle portions, exceed-
ingly fertile. Capital, Clarksville.
Red River, a r. rising in Iowa Territory, and
flowing northerly, falls into L. Winnipeg,
in British America. About 50 m. from its
mouth, it receives the Assiniboin.

REFUGIO, a co. in the 's part of Texas, N of,
and bordering on, the r. Nueces: soil gene-
rally rich, and well adapted to the growth
of cotton and sugar.

Refugio, a v. of Texas, cap. of the above co.;
now mostly in ruins, though it was formerly
a place of considerable commercial im-
portance. Present pop. about 100.

Rro GRANDE, (Sp. pron. ree'o gran'day,) i. e.
"great river," or RIO GRANDE DE SANTIAGO,
a Mexican river which rises near the city
of Mexico, by its principal branch the
Lerma, and after flowing north-westerly
and receiving the waters of Lake Cha-
pala, falls into the Pacific at San Blas,
Lat. about 21° 30' N. Next to the Rio del
Norte, it is the largest river of Mexico.

SACRAMENTO r. called by the Spaniards, RIO
SACRAMENTO, ree'o sah'kra-mento, a r.
which rises in the s part of Oregon, and flow-
ing southerly falls into San Francisco Bay.
Length above 400 m. About 50 m. from its
mouth it receives the Rio de los America-
nos, ree'o del loce ah-mer'e-kah'noce, i. e.
the "river of the Americans," a small stream
on which the important American settle-
ment of New Helvetia has been made.
The valley of the Sacramento is among the
finest portions of California.

SALVADOR, sal-và-dore', a state of Central
America, bordering on the Pacific. It is
the most populous part of Central America.
Nearly all the indigo exported from Guate-
mala is grown here. Capital, San Salvador.

SAN AUGUSTINE, san au-gus-teen', a co. in the
E part of Texas, on the Sabine r. Soil ex-
tremely fertile, much the greater portion
being included in the tract known as the
"Red Lands," noted for its fine cotton.
San Augustine, city, cap. of the above co. on
an affluent of the Neches, 190 m. NE of
Galveston. Here is a university. San Au.
gustine is one of the handsomest towns in
Texas. Pop. about 1,500.
SAN BARTOLOME, baR-to-lo-mă', a t. of Mex-
ico, in Chihuahua, near 270 N Lat. and 1040
40 w Lon. Pop. said to be 20,000.
SAN BLAS, a sea-port of Jalisco, on the w
coast of Mexico, 420 m. nw of the city of
Mexico. It stands on an island at the
mouth of the Rio Grande de Santiago.
This locality is very unhealthy during the

warm season.

SAN FRANCIsco, a small t. of California, at
the entrance of a bay of its own name, with
one of the finest harbours on the w coast
of America. Lat. 37 45' N, Lon. 122995 w
SAN JACINTO, a r. of Texas, flowing into
Galveston Bay, 25 ENE of Houston. Near
its mouth was fought (April 21st, 1836,) the
battle which established the independence

of Texas.

SAN JOAQUIN (Sp. pron. san нo-ah-keen), a r.
of California, flows northerly, and joins the
Sacramento at its entrance into San Fran-
cisco Bay. The valley of this river is one
of the best parts of California.

SAN JUAN (Sp. pron. san ноo-an' or Hwan), a
1. on the Pacific coast, 30 m. s of the Pueblo
de los Angeles, important as being the head
quarters of the Mexican forces in Califor

nia.

SAN JUAN DE ULUA (00-loo'ă) or ULO'A (Sp.
pron. san Hoo-an' da oo-loo^a), the citadel of
Vera Cruz, and the most important for
tress of all Mexico, is situated on a litte
island immediately N of Vera Cruz. Its goo-
struction is said to have cost more than
30,000,000 dollars.
